Bitcoin Market Experiences Extreme Fear Amidst Volatility

Bitcoin Market Experiences Extreme Fear Amidst Volatility

According to Crypto Rover, the Bitcoin market is currently experiencing extreme fear, as indicated by a significant drop in investor confidence. This sentiment often suggests potential market volatility, which traders should monitor closely to adjust their positions accordingly.

On February 26, 2025, the cryptocurrency market, particularly Bitcoin (BTC), experienced a surge in extreme fear sentiment, as indicated by the Crypto Fear & Greed Index reaching an extreme fear level of 20 out of 100 (source: Crypto Rover on X, February 26, 2025). This spike in fear was evidenced by Bitcoin's price dropping sharply from $58,000 at 10:00 AM UTC to $54,000 by 12:00 PM UTC, marking a decline of approximately 6.9% within two hours (source: CoinMarketCap, February 26, 2025). Concurrently, the trading volume for Bitcoin surged from 20,000 BTC at 10:00 AM UTC to 45,000 BTC at 12:00 PM UTC, reflecting heightened market activity and panic selling (source: CoinGecko, February 26, 2025). The impact was also visible across other major cryptocurrencies, with Ethereum (ETH) dropping from $3,200 to $3,000 over the same period, a decline of 6.25% (source: CoinMarketCap, February 26, 2025). The sentiment shift also affected AI-related tokens, such as SingularityNET (AGIX), which saw a price decline from $0.80 to $0.72, a drop of 10% (source: CoinGecko, February 26, 2025).

The trading implications of this extreme fear sentiment are multifaceted. The sharp decline in Bitcoin's price led to significant liquidations, with $1.2 billion in long positions liquidated within the two-hour period (source: Coinglass, February 26, 2025). This event triggered a cascade effect across the market, with increased volatility observed in trading pairs such as BTC/USDT and ETH/USDT, both experiencing heightened volatility with 24-hour realized volatility jumping to 4.5% and 5.2%, respectively (source: Kaiko, February 26, 2025). For traders, this presents opportunities for short-term trading strategies, such as short selling or buying put options, particularly in the BTC/USDT pair. The increased volatility also suggests potential entry points for long-term investors looking to buy at lower prices. The correlation between Bitcoin's price movement and AI-related tokens like AGIX indicates a broader market sentiment shift, where fear in the market can disproportionately affect smaller, more speculative assets (source: Messari, February 26, 2025).

Technical analysis of Bitcoin's price action on February 26, 2025, reveals several key indicators.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) for Bitcoin dropped from 70 to 30 within the two-hour period, signaling a shift from overbought to oversold conditions (source: TradingView, February 26, 2025). The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D) also indicated a bearish crossover, with the MACD line crossing below the signal line at 11:30 AM UTC, further confirming the bearish trend (source: TradingView, February 26, 2025). Trading volumes for BTC/USDT on major exchanges like Binance and Coinbase saw a significant increase, with Binance reporting a volume of 25,000 BTC at 12:00 PM UTC, up from 15,000 BTC at 10:00 AM UTC (source: Binance, February 26, 2025). On-chain metrics for Bitcoin showed a spike in transaction volume, with the number of transactions increasing from 200,000 at 10:00 AM UTC to 350,000 by 12:00 PM UTC, indicating heightened network activity and potential capitulation (source: Glassnode, February 26, 2025). The fear sentiment's impact on AI-related tokens is evident in the on-chain metrics for AGIX, with a 20% increase in trading volume from 10:00 AM UTC to 12:00 PM UTC, suggesting that fear-driven selling was more pronounced in these tokens (source: CoinGecko, February 26, 2025). The correlation between AI developments and the crypto market sentiment can be seen in the increased trading volume of AI tokens during periods of market fear, as investors may perceive these tokens as riskier and more susceptible to market swings (source: Messari, February 26, 2025).
